Treatment protocol Surgically resected hepatocellular carcinoma (HCC) samples and surrounded non-tumor samples, and cholangiocarcinoma (CCC) samples and surrounded non-tumor samples
Extracted molecule total RNA
Extraction protocol RNA was prepared using the mirVana miRNA isolation kit (Life Technologies, CA, USA) following the manufacturer's recommendations. RNA was quantified using a NanoDrop-2000 spectrophotometer and quality was monitored with the Agilent 2100 Bioanalyzer (Agilent Technologies, Santa Clara, CA).
Label Cy3
Label protocol For miRNA microarray, 100 ng of RNA was labeled and hybridized using the Human microRNA Microarray Kit (Rel 14.0) (Agilent Technologies, CA, USA) according to manufacturer’s protocol for use with Agilent microRNA microarrays Version 1.0.For mRNA micaroarray, 100 ng of RNA was labeled and hybridized using the SurePrint G3 Human GE microarray kit (G4851B) (Agilent Technologies, CA, USA) according to manufacturer’s protocol for use with Agilent microarrays.
 
Hybridization protocol For miRNA microarray, 100 ng of RNA was labeled and hybridized using the Human microRNA Microarray Kit (Rel 14.0) (Agilent Technologies, CA, USA) according to manufacturer’s protocol for use with Agilent microRNA microarrays Version 1.0.For mRNA micaroarray, 100 ng of RNA was labeled and hybridized using the SurePrint G3 Human GE microarray kit (G4851B) (Agilent Technologies, CA, USA) according to manufacturer’s protocol for use with Agilent microarrays.
Scan protocol For miRNA microarray, hybridization signals were detected with Agilent DNA microarray scanner G2539B and the scanned images were analyzed using Agilent feature extraction software (v10.10.1.1). For mRNA microarray, hybridization signals were detected with Agilent DNA microarray scanner G2539A and the scanned images were analyzed using Agilent feature extraction software (v10.10.1.1).
